Make ProcessWatcher use kqueues on Mac.
* Port ProcessWatcher::EnsureProcessTerminated() to kqueue() APIs on OS X. * Make ProcessWatcher::EnsureProcessGetsReaped() Linux-only, since it's only used there. * Add a unit test. BUG=12731 TEST=Open Chrome/Mac, open and close a few tabs. Processes shouldn't stay around.
